金佰旭 一、需求分析 每一个项目的开始都源于一个明确的需求。在这个阶段,开发团队会与客户
首页 » 行业资讯 » 文章详情

一、需求分析

每一个项目的开始都源于一个明确的需求。在这个阶段,开发团队会与客户沟通交流,了解他们的具体需求和期望。通过一系列的会议和讨论,最终形成一份详细的需求文档。这一步骤看似简单,实则需要开发者具备良好的沟通能力和耐心。

二、设计

在明确了需求之后,接下来就是进行系统的设计工作。开发团队会根据需求文档制定出具体的解决方案,并绘制出系统的架构图和界面原型。这一过程不仅考验着开发者的创造力,还需要他们具备扎实的技术功底。

三、编码

设计完成后,真正的“魔法”即将开始——编码阶段。在这里,开发者会将设计方案转化为实际的代码,并构建出一个完整的软件系统。这个过程中可能会遇到各种各样的问题,而解决问题的过程也正是开发者的成长之路。

四、测试

当所有功能都实现完毕后,接下来就是进行严格的测试工作了。通过不同类型的测试(如单元测试、集成测试等),确保软件的稳定性和可靠性。这个阶段往往需要团队成员密切配合,共同保障产品质量。

五、上线与维护

经过层层验证后,软件终于可以正式上线了!但这并不意味着开发工作的结束。在后续的使用过程中,还可能发现一些新问题或需求变更,这就要求开发者们继续保持对系统的关注,并及时进行相应的调整和优化。

总结

通过上述几个步骤可以看出,软件开发并非一蹴而就的过程,而是需要经历多个阶段层层递进才能完成的复杂任务。它不仅考验着开发者的技术水平,更锻炼了他们的沟通能力、团队协作精神以及解决问题的能力。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。

相关文章

« 上一篇:软件开发是做什么的?揭秘幕后技术工匠 下一篇:软件开发是做什么的?让我们一步步揭开这个神秘面纱。 »